Facilities Ticket — Cleaning Crew Access, Brindle Annex

For new starters handling evening lock-up: the Sorano Cleaning crew arrives nightly at 21:30 via the annex side door. Check their rota sheet, note arrival in the log, and ensure the storeroom is relocked afterward. To let them through the side door, enter the access code below.

badge for yaweg-hafog: bdg-GX-6

Handover note — Facilities desk, Ashcombe Wing

For Priya, from Tomas: first-aid room restock arrived Tuesday; everything shelved except the eyewash refills, which are still in the store cupboard. The incident logbook is nearly full — a fresh one is on order. Defib check is due Friday; tick the wall sheet when done. The room keypad was reprogrammed yesterday, so use the new code below.

staff pass of kawip-hawef = bdg-QLP-2

Checklist item 9: SDK feature parity. Before approving the release, confirm the Fernwick client SDKs for Kestrel and Lumen runtimes expose identical public surfaces: same methods, error codes, retry semantics, and pagination behavior. Run the parity matrix generator and attach its report to the review. Any intentional divergence must be documented with rationale. Unresolved gaps block the release and must be raised with the parity owner named below.

account owner for bawip-tahag: Raleth Quenok

**Changelog — Tracewire v2.4 (weekly sync)**

Renamed `TRACE_PROPAGATE` to `TRACEWIRE_PROPAGATION_MODE` across all Lanterbeck microservices. Old name still read with a deprecation warning until v2.6. Span IDs now survive hops through the Quillgate proxy; the orderflow and billing services pick them up automatically. No action needed for services on the shared chart — the rename is handled by the config shim. Self-hosted deployments must update their env files by hand. Collector auth is unchanged; add the collector token on the next line.

sealed setting: RELAY_SECRET5=82864